The KOVAR Committee
holds its meetings at St. Thomas Aquinas and they are open to the public. I
stopped by to see how they operated and found that they are very diligent when it comes to doling out money. Each
request that they get is investigated as to the total amount sought and merit
of the request. Some requests are investigated two or three times. The bottom
line is that none of the money is wasted. Some of the organizations that receive
the money include Special Olympics, Breadworks, and Region 10.
